Kalank’s gorgeous new poster is Alia Bhatt’s birthday gift from Karan Johar. See it here

A new poster from Kalank was shared by Karan Johar on Alia Bhatt’s birthday. The actor plays Roop in the period drama.

bollywood Updated: Mar 15, 2019 13:01 IST
Alia Bhatt plays Roop in Kalank.

Days after sharing the teaser of the film, makers of Kalank are now sharing new character posters from the film and the latest one to land is Alia Bhatt’s Roop. Thursday saw character posters of the male protagonists - Varun Dhawan, Aditya Roy Kapur and Sanjay Dutt. The new Kalank poster featuring Alia also coincided with the actor’s birthday.

In the new poster, a closeup of Alia is seen as hope shines in her eyes and the background of the image shows what looks like the setting for a play. The poster has the tagline ‘Love fiercely, live fearlessly’. Sharing the poster, Dharma Productions tweeted, “Love fiercely, live fearlessly. Talking at the teaser launch of the film, Alia had said, “I have a lot of love for my director and my friend. He has put in a lot of effort and hard work to make it happen. He is the nicest and most amazing human being in the world. He is so nice that I just wish that the film just kills it. He deserves all the success and love in the world.”

Alia and Varun are coming together for the fourth time in Kalank after Student of The Year, Badrinath Ki Dulhaniya and Humpty Sharma Ki Dulhaniya.

A love story set in 1940s India, Kalank was Karan’s father Yash Johar’s dream project. The film was delayed for several years and has now been directed by Abhishek Varman of 2 States fame. Kalank will hit theatres on April 17.
